Wanted woman gets caught, escapes again

Chennai, Feb 12 (UNI) A 36-year-old woman, wanted by the Mumbai police for the last two years, was detained by the immigration authorities at the Anna international airport here last night, but she once again managed to give a slip to them early today.

Airport soruces said the woman, Alamelu Lakshmikanth, had been evading the Mumbai police for the last couple of years in connection with a case. The Mumbai police had alerted the immigration authorities in all the airports to prevent her from fleeing the country.

When she came to the airport to board a Malaysian Airlines flight to Kuala Lumpur, immigration authorities cancelled her journey and detained her at around 2345 hrs last night.

They also informed the Mumbai police, who in turn asked them to hand her over to the airport police and a special team from Mumbai would take her into custody after obtaining transit remand.

As the immigration authorities allegedly delayed the process of handing her over to the airport police, the woman hoodwinked them and escaped.

Special teams have been formed to nab her.
